initium, initii, n
beginning
ops, opis, f
help, aid in pl. - power resources, wealth
philosophus, philosophi, m, can be feminine
philosopher
plebs, plebis, f
common people, populace, plebians
sal, salis, m
salt, wit
speculum, speculi, n
mirror
quis, quid after si, nisi, ne, num
anyone, anything, someone, something
candidus-a-um
shining, bright, white, beautiful
merus-a-um
pure, undiluted
suavis, suave
sweet
-ve as suffix to a word = aut
or
heu
ah! alas!
subito
suddenly
recuso (1)
to refuse
trado, tradere, tradidi, traditum (3)
to give over, surrender, hand down, transmit, teach
